PWA SEO: Оптимизация PWA для повышения лояльности пользователей

Что такое PWA и почему SEO для них важен?

Progressive Web Apps (PWA) – это веб-приложения, которые сочетают в себе лучшее из двух миров: веб и нативные приложения. Они предлагают пользователям быстрый, надежный и увлекательный опыт, работая на любом устройстве и в любом браузере. PWA могут работать в автономном режиме, отправлять push-уведомления и добавляться на главный экран устройства, как обычные приложения. Однако, несмотря на все преимущества, PWA нуждаются в SEO-оптимизации, чтобы быть найденными в поисковых системах и привлекать новых пользователей.

Основные принципы SEO для PWA

SEO для PWA имеет некоторые особенности, отличающиеся от традиционной SEO для веб-сайтов. Важно учитывать, что PWA – это, прежде всего, веб-приложение, поэтому базовые принципы SEO остаются актуальными. Но есть и дополнительные аспекты, на которые стоит обратить внимание:

Индексация и сканирование

  • robots.txt: Убедитесь, что ваш файл robots.txt не блокирует сканирование важных страниц PWA.
  • Sitemap.xml: Предоставьте поисковым системам карту сайта (sitemap.xml), чтобы помочь им быстрее и эффективнее индексировать ваше PWA.
  • Канонические URL: Используйте канонические URL, чтобы указать поисковым системам предпочтительную версию страницы, особенно если у вас есть несколько URL, ведущих к одному и тому же контенту.
  • Структурированные данные: Используйте структурированные данные (Schema.org) для предоставления поисковым системам дополнительной информации о вашем контенте.

Скорость загрузки

Скорость загрузки – критически важный фактор для SEO и пользовательского опыта. PWA должны быть максимально быстрыми. Вот несколько способов улучшить скорость загрузки:

  • Оптимизация изображений: Сжимайте изображения без потери качества.
  • Минификация CSS и JavaScript: Уменьшите размер файлов CSS и JavaScript.
  • Кэширование: Используйте кэширование для хранения статических ресурсов.
  • Content Delivery Network (CDN): Используйте CDN для доставки контента пользователям с ближайшего сервера.

Мобильная оптимизация

PWA должны быть полностью адаптивными и оптимизированными для мобильных устройств. Убедитесь, что ваш PWA корректно отображается на всех экранах и обеспечивает удобный пользовательский опыт на мобильных устройствах.

Push-уведомления и вовлечение пользователей

Push-уведомления – мощный инструмент для повышения вовлеченности пользователей и возврата их в ваше PWA. Используйте push-уведомления для отправки персонализированных сообщений, новостей и специальных предложений.

Service Worker и автономный режим

Service Worker – ключевой компонент PWA, который позволяет им работать в автономном режиме и кэшировать ресурсы. Убедитесь, что ваш Service Worker правильно настроен и эффективно кэширует ресурсы, чтобы обеспечить быстрый и надежный опыт для пользователей.

Примеры успешных PWA

Несмотря на то, что PWA не так широко распространены в России, как в других странах, есть несколько примеров успешных PWA, которые демонстрируют их потенциал. Например, (Ele.me) – китайский сервис доставки еды – был одним из первых разработчиков PWA. Они смогли значительно улучшить вовлеченность пользователей и увеличить количество заказов благодаря PWA.

Будущее PWA и SEO

PWA – это перспективная технология, которая продолжает развиваться. В будущем мы можем ожидать, что PWA станут еще более популярными и важными для SEO. Поисковые системы, такие как Google, будут уделять все больше внимания PWA и ранжировать их выше в результатах поиска.

Важно помнить: PWA предназначены для использования на компьютере и требуют Google Chrome версии 73 и выше.